Programme Specifications and Regulations 2012-2013
A current Programme Specification and Regulations (PSR) document is provided for each programme in the table below.
Programme specifications are concise descriptions of the intended learning outcomes from each programme and how these outcomes can be achieved and demonstrated.
Regulations are the rules that govern a student’s registration with the University.
Each PSR is updated annually and made available on our website. Note that the current version replaces all previous versions. The PSRs are titled '2012-13' for programmes with registration in 2012 and exams in the 2013 and titled ‘2013’ where registration and exams are both in 2013.
The 2011-12 PSRs are available for reference. Sometimes the PSR refers to the Student Handbook for detailed advice about procedures, deadlines and other matters, so the two documents must be read together.
